CdTe core-type quantum dots CdTe core-type quantum dots. Uses: Cadmium telluride quantum dots (cdte qds) are available in solid form. they are coated with carboxyl groups which makes them water soluble to make aqueous solutions. these carboxyl functionalized hydrophilic quantum dots can be further conjugated for use as labels. cdte qds can be used for optical and display applications; solar cells and biomedical applications. Cellulose Cellulose is an odorless, white powdery fibers. Density: 1.5 g/cm³. The biopolymer composing the cell wall of vegetable tissues. Prepared by treating cotton with an organic solvent to de-wax it and removing pectic acids by extration with a solution of sodium hydroxide. The principal fiber composing the cell wall of vegetable tissues (wood, cotton, flax, grass, etc.). Technical uses depend on the strength and flexibility of its fibers. Insoluble in water. Soluble with chemical degradation in sulfuric aicd, and in concentrated solutions of zinc chloride. Soluble in aqueous solutions of cupric ammonium hydroxide (Cu(NH3)4(OH)2).;A white, odourless powder;Odorless, white substance.;Odorless, white substance. [Note: The principal fiber cell wall material of vegetable tissues (wood, cotton, flax, grass, etc.).]. Group: Natural polymers and biopolymers. CAS No. 9004-34-6. Pack Sizes: 25 kg. Cellulose Acetate Cellulose acetate was used in the fabrication of gold microelectrode for electrochemical monochloramine measurement. Cellulose acetate based membranes are used in the separations in aqueous systems and in reverse osmosis process. It has been reported to be used to desalinate seawater.Cellulose acetate was used for biosensor encapsulation. It was used in the preparation of cellulose acetate nanofibre felt structure, cellulose acetate fibers. Uses: Used as a polymer (acetate fibers, yarn, and plastics), waterproofing agent (fabrics), and to make rubber and celluloid substitutes; also used in nonflammable photographic films, varnishes and lacquers, filaments, phonograph records; magnetic tapes, coatings for skins, wire insulation, thermoplastic molds, cell membranes, sewage treatment, and food packaging.
